What is an Uber Rider Rating?

Your Uber rider rating is a score based on the feedback provided by drivers after each trip. Drivers rate you on a scale, typically from one to five stars, after you've completed your ride. This rating is an important metric for Uber, reflecting the overall experience drivers have with you as a passenger. A consistently low rating can lead to serious consequences, including account restrictions or even permanent account termination.

Factors Affecting Your Uber Rider Rating:

Several factors contribute to your Uber rating. While Uber doesn't publicly disclose the exact algorithm, common elements include:

  • Punctuality: Being ready and waiting on time significantly impacts your rating. Drivers appreciate prompt passengers who don't make them wait unnecessarily.
  • Cleanliness: Maintaining a clean and tidy demeanor inside the vehicle contributes to a positive driver experience. Avoid bringing excessive baggage or leaving behind messes.
  • Respectful Communication: Polite and courteous interaction with the driver is paramount. Treat them with respect and avoid aggressive or inappropriate behavior.
  • Following Directions: Clearly communicating your destination and avoiding unnecessary detours or changes during the trip help keep the ride smooth.
  • Adhering to Uber's Policies: Following Uber's rules and regulations, such as wearing seatbelts and not consuming alcohol or drugs during the ride, is crucial for maintaining a high rating.

What Happens When Your Uber Rider Rating is Low?

A consistently low Uber rider rating can lead to several repercussions, including:

  • Account Restrictions: Uber may limit your access to certain ride options or impose longer wait times.
  • Account Suspension: In severe cases, Uber might temporarily or permanently suspend your account, preventing you from using the service.
  • Reduced Driver Availability: Drivers may be less likely to accept your ride requests if your rating is low, leading to longer wait times or failed requests.

How to Improve Your Uber Rider Rating:

Improving your Uber rating involves focusing on the key factors mentioned above. Here are some actionable steps:

  • Be Prompt: Allow ample time to get ready and be waiting at the designated pickup location.
  • Communicate Clearly: Clearly communicate your destination and any special requests politely to the driver.
  • Maintain Cleanliness: Keep your belongings organized and clean, avoiding any mess in the vehicle.
  • Be Respectful: Treat your driver with the same courtesy and respect you'd expect from anyone.
  • Provide Constructive Feedback: If you have a negative experience, provide constructive feedback through the app, focusing on specific issues rather than personal attacks.
  • Check Your Rating Regularly: Monitor your Uber rider rating through the app to track your progress and identify areas for improvement.
